Real-risk guard clauses (the part that actually fixes bugs):
- src/ui/statusbar.c _tabs_width: `end > opened_tabs - 1` rewritten
  as `end < opened_tabs` so opened_tabs == 0 no longer underflows.
- src/ui/statusbar.c _status_bar_draw_extended_tabs: the mirror
  comparison rewritten as `end >= opened_tabs`.
- src/ui/statusbar.c status_bar_draw: replaced
  `MAX(0, getmaxx - (int)_tabs_width)` with an explicit precheck
  before subtraction.
- src/omemo/omemo.c prekey selection: prekey_index is now uint32_t
  and randomized into an unsigned buffer, so modulo with prekeys_len
  cannot yield a negative index for g_list_nth_data.
- src/omemo/crypto.c omemo_decrypt_func: PKCS#5/PKCS#7 unpadding
  reads `plaintext[plaintext_len - 1]`, which would underflow on a
  malformed empty ciphertext and read past the heap buffer. Reject
  plaintext_len == 0 before the padding peek and validate the
  padding byte against the buffer length before the unpad loop.
  Initialise plaintext = NULL so the early `goto out` cannot free
  uninitialised memory.
- src/ui/inputwin.c (4 mbrlen sites) and src/ui/window.c
  _win_print_wrapped: mbrlen() returns 0 for the null wide
  character. The existing checks rejected (size_t)-1 / -2 but
  treated 0 as a valid step, so the surrounding loops would either
  advance by SIZE_MAX (i += ch_len - 1) or spin in place
  (word_pos += 0 forever). Add `|| ch_len == 0` to each guard;
  inside the spell-check word-emission loop also fall back to a
  one-byte advance.
- Defensive `len > 0 ? len - 1 : 0` prechecks at the strlen-based
  g_strndup / loop sites in ui/console.c, plugins/c_api.c and
  plugins/python_plugins.c.

Michael Vetter
19de066008 Call ncurses resize function before move function
From @xaizek s comment on issue #1235:
```
If the move would cause the window to be off the screen, it is an error and the window
is not moved.

Resize on the other hand doesn't fail like this according to its documentation. So new size needs to be applied first.
```
